The Architecture of a Freestanding Unit

When you’re evaluating the anatomy of these units, the base is where the design’s personality truly emerges. You’ll typically choose between three main styles:

  • Tapered or Carved Legs: These create an airy, open feel that’s perfect for making smaller Los Angeles bathrooms appear larger.
  • Solid Plinths: These provide a grounded, more traditional appearance that feels exceptionally sturdy.
  • Furniture-Style Kickplates: These offer the look of a dresser while hiding the floor beneath, making cleaning a bit simpler.

High-end designs frequently feature integrated countertops made of resilient materials like quartz, though separate tops allow for more creative agency during your project. Because our local homes can experience significant humidity fluctuations within the bathroom, solid construction is a non-negotiable requirement for long-term performance. Investing in high-quality freestanding vanities Los Angeles homeowners can rely on ensures your cabinetry won’t warp or degrade after only a few years of use.

The Single Sink vs. Double Sink Decision

Deciding between a single or double sink often comes down to a trade-off between luxury counter space and household harmony. In a guest bath or a smaller primary suite, opting for a 48-inch bathroom vanity allows for maximum single-sink luxury, providing ample room for morning rituals without overcrowding the layout. Conversely, for sprawling master suites in Calabasas, a 60-inch or 72-inch double sink vanity is practically essential for both daily convenience and long-term resale value. Always remember the “Golden Rule” of clearance: ensure you have enough physical footprint for drawers and doors to swing fully open without hitting your shower door or toilet.

Material Resilience and Aesthetic Discernment

Achieving true “quiet luxury” requires a focus on tactile, high-quality materials that withstand the test of time. While marble offers a classic look, many LA renovators now prefer quartz countertops because they handle the rigors of daily use without the staining or etching risks of natural stone. When it comes to the cabinet itself, solid wood is the gold standard for longevity, especially in the fluctuating humidity of a bathroom. Unlike MDF, which can swell if moisture penetrates the finish, solid wood provides the material resilience needed for a multi-decade investment. Choosing a finish that complements your existing tile involves looking at the undertones; a warm walnut vanity beautifully offsets cool-toned porcelain, creating a balanced, professional-grade aesthetic.

Storage capacity is another critical factor where the two styles diverge. Freestanding models utilize the entire vertical space from the floor to the countertop, providing full-height cabinetry that floating units simply can’t match. If you’re managing a busy household, those extra ten inches of storage at the base are often the difference between a cluttered countertop and a clean, spa-like environment. While floating units make mopping the floor easier, they also leave your plumbing and the floor beneath fully exposed. A freestanding unit with a solid base or a furniture-style kickplate prevents dust from accumulating in hard-to-reach spots, keeping your sanctuary looking pristine with significantly less effort.

Selection Guide: Measuring and Planning Your Los Angeles Remodel

Have you already fallen in love with a specific design, only to realize you aren’t sure if the drawers will actually clear your shower door? Choosing the right freestanding vanities Los Angeles homes require means looking beyond the aesthetic finish to the literal inches of your layout. The “Golden Rule” of clearance is your best friend here; you must ensure that all cabinet doors and vanity drawers can swing or slide to their full extension without hitting the toilet, the entry door, or the glass of your shower. If you’re working with a tighter LA bungalow layout, even a two-inch miscalculation can turn a luxury upgrade into a daily frustration.

Plumbing alignment is another area where professional reassurance saves the day. Unlike custom cabinetry built on-site, a freestanding unit comes with a pre-cut back opening. You’ll want to measure the exact height and width of your existing wall pipes to ensure they align with the vanity’s interior shelf or drawer cutouts. If you’re planning for 2026, you’ll also notice a major shift toward “comfort height” vanities. While older models often sat at 30 or 32 inches, modern standards have climbed to 36 inches to reduce back strain during your morning routine. Don’t forget the “Wet Zone” either; while LA code often focuses on plumbing safety, practical longevity requires a proper backsplash and side-splash to protect your drywall from the inevitable splashes of a high-traffic family bathroom.

Navigating Standard Sizes

When you begin your search, it’s helpful to reference a comprehensive Bathroom Vanity Sizes guide to understand the standard dimensions available. While 60-inch models are common for master suites, we find that 36-inch and 42-inch units are the “sweet spot” for guest baths, offering a generous countertop without overwhelming the room’s flow. Always consider the depth of the unit as well; a standard 21-inch depth is typical, but narrower 18-inch models can be life-savers for maintaining clear walkways in narrow powder rooms.

The Mirror and Lighting Equation

Your vanity is only half of the visual equation. To maintain perfect balance, your mirror should generally be about two to four inches narrower than the vanity itself. In modern LA designs, we’re seeing a shift toward side-mounted sconces rather than overhead bar lights, as side lighting provides a more flattering, shadow-free glow for your reflection. What is the best material for a durable bathroom vanity in California?

Solid wood paired with a quartz countertop is the gold standard for material resilience and long-term performance. Unlike MDF, solid wood handles the humidity fluctuations common in Southern California bathrooms without swelling or warping over time. Quartz tops are particularly popular because they resist staining and etching much better than natural marble; this ensures your investment maintains its premium look through years of heavy daily use.

Can I install a freestanding vanity myself or do I need a pro?

While a confident DIYer can often handle the physical placement, we recommend hiring a licensed plumber for the final water and drain connections. Properly sealing the sink and ensuring your drain lines align with the new unit’s back opening is crucial for preventing long-term water damage. How much space should be between the vanity and the toilet?

You should aim for at least 15 inches from the center of the toilet to the side of your vanity to meet standard building codes. This spacing ensures enough room for comfortable use and easy cleaning of the surrounding floor area.
